Located in the heart of South East Asia, in close proximity with Thailand (West), Laos (North) and Vietnam (East), Cambodia is a promising holiday destination. The improved social, economical and security conditions have multiplied the numbers of visitors rediscovering Cambodia’s temples and beaches each year. It is why, the city ‘Siem Reap’, the gateway to Angkor, now sports luxury hotels, chic nightspots and an International airport fielding flights from all over the world. Also the reputation of ‘Sihanoukville’ is raising in the west as an up-and-coming holiday beach destination.

A heady cocktail of Bollywood, affluent power-moguls, a cache of colonial relics, swish bars and restaurants, buzzing cafes and a dash of pollution and poverty, Mumbai is a great Indian city that can also be referred to as the exact miniature of the country. Mumbai, formerly known as Bombay presents an inebriating mix of mayhem and order in equal parts. Add to it a sprawling mass of humanity that in itself is a study in contrast. What with followers of almost all world religions and communities making Mumbai their home! Mumbai is not just the financial capital of India, but is also a leader in the fields of fashion, culture and films. An ideal centre for after-dark adventures and frolics, travelers from around the world can be seen reveling in the city’s night clubs and pubs till the wee hours. Jorhat is the nerve centre of the Indian tea industry. It is said to be the best travel destination as it is surrounded by splendid tea gardens. If you want to experience its charismatic nature then you have to travel to Jorhat.
Jorhat is in Assam and it is the centre of the tea industry. For miles it is surrounded by picturesque tea plantations. In Jorhat there is an Assam Agricultural University and the Regional Research Laboratory. Here the advanced research is carried out on plants, soil and herbs. This city was once upon a time the capital of the Ahom Kings. This city also has an ancient heritage too. Vaishnavite culture of Majauli is situated here which is the largest river island in the world.
